Kateaqteril

Tenth Month of the Year

Kateaqteril, or Katea's month, is the 10th month of the year in the Hillenistic Calendar. It is named after Katea of Ualei, the Hillenist patron saint of birds and their caretakers. There are 30 days within the month, and it is preceded by Tlealēlcpēh and followed by Iqtīlapoiteril. In Lethea, the 5th of Kateaqteril marks the beginning of winter.  

Significant Events

  • Start of the Heinasi Uprising in Alminthas (Kateaqteril 4, 1457 AA)
  • Netterholz's Coup in Aussel (Kateaqteril 1-3, 1534 AA)
  • Battle of the Lipsig Hills in Aussel (Kateaqteril 3, 1540 AA)
  • Cilie Vehlow becomes wartime dictator of Aussel (Kateaqteril 16, 1540 AA)
  • Battle of Neittinge in Aussel (Kateaqteril 21, 1540 AA)
